Transaction 81e93d23f4a69523c382b1e9efe2fc24bdad00b3eea7b148bee7c5b8750f1e8d
1 Input
1 Output
-
81e93d23f4a69523c382b1e9efe2fc24bdad00b3eea7b148bee7c5b8750f1e8d:0
- value
- 489736396
- script pubkey
- OP_0 OP_PUSHBYTES_20 517555e4a50459c9bb969720b7048516bf86250e
- address
- bc1q2964te99q3vunwukjustwpy9z6lcvfgwnlgchj